Hi, Because you have used just an input address, which does not exist in hardware configuration or youhave used a module which is not released for your PCS7 version, then generating automatic inputs like Mode is not possible. You have to set the mode manually in this case, which is normally done by PCS7 according to your type of input. In this case it is a bool, so set the Mode to 16#8000FFFF. You can find in the helpfile a list of possible modes. For a 4-20mA signal, the mode is 16#80000203. |

Hi, Thank you for the feedback (and rating). If you open hardware configuration, you can add a for example a ET200M module, with a few digital in/outputs and some analog in/outputs. Make sure that the PCS7_V82 Catalog is selected in the top right corner because then all released modules for your PCS7 version can be selected. When compiling your AS program (CFC charts), you can select/deselect the option to generate module drivers. You can deselect this option, but next time during compile, the setting is enabled again. What happens now when choosing to generate module drivers, is that a few interconnections are created automatically between your hardware configuration and CFC program by means of the PCS7 driver blocks. You can receive additional diagnostic information from the hardware I/O through the driver blocks. I made some screenshots for you to show how to do this. Good luck!
